PRICES ARE MIXED IN BOMKET Utilities and Rails Off in . Early Trading as U. S. Is sues Work Higher. BY BERNARD S. OUARA, Associated Press Financial Writer. NEW YORK. November 16—Cor porate bonds gave an uneven perform ance today, due to rather heavy sell ing In certain issues, notably utilities end secondary rails. United States Governments, on the other hand, • added moderately to their gains of the previous sessions. Trading was In moderate volume. Obligations of electric light and power and communications companies were inclined to soften in sympathy with the lower trend of common stocks. American Telephone 5s eased about half a point to 11038 and on greater ■ or lesser losses Consolidated Gas 5^2 s sold at 105'2. St. Paul 5s at 21S, Southern Pacific 4> 2s at 60, Interna tional Telephone 5s at 58V* and West ern Union 5s at 83 V*. The loans, recording moderate gains In the early trading, included Amer ican Power 5s, which sold at 53 %; Armour & Co. 4*2S at 101%, Detroit Edison 4l^s at 1061/* and Southern Railway 4s at 58 V«. The Federal list worked ahead from 1/32 to 9/32ds of a point during the forenoon trading. Home Owners' Loan 2a4s edged up 7/32ds to 95.24, while the 3s gained 5 32ds at 98.24. Federal Farm Mortgage 3s were up 9/32ds at 98.25. Treasury 4s rose 8/32ds to 107.20 and similar improve ment was registered by the 4 V*-3 Vis and the 33es of 1946-49. , In the foreign division prices shift ed irregularly in light trading. Bel gian loans were soft, while those of Australia, Argentina and Japan im proved within a fractional range. FOOD INDEX ADVANCES NEW YORK. November 16 (A3).— Dun & Bradstreet's weekly food in dex stood at $2.43 for the week ended November 13, compared with $2.41 in the preceding week and $2.00 in the same week last year. The current in dex equals the 4-year high established on September 25, and shows an in crease of 6 cents, or 2.5 per cent since the present forward swing began three • weeks ago. MONTREAL SILVER. NEW YORK, November 18.—Cotton future# opened steady, 4 to 7 points advance In response to higher Liver pool cables and on trade buying. De cember. 12.32; January. 12.39; March, 12.45; May, 12.45; July, 12.41; Octo ber, 12.12. There were comparatively few sell ing orders iron the South, while houses with Liverpool connections were moderate buyers. The Initial demand was supplied by realizing or liquidation and prices sagged olT a few points right after the call. De cember after selling up to 12.34, re acted to 12.29, while March eased off from 12.45 to 12.41. Orders seemed to be pretty evenly divided and the market held steady at the end of the first half hour with active months ruling about 2 to 5 points net higher. Houses with trade connections abroad, said Liverpool in terests, were buying on new arbitrage operations, apparently in expectation of narrowing differences between the two markets. Early cables from Liverpool re ported a quiet market there with prices steady on scattered buying, partly for Bombay and continental ac count. The buying tapered off somewhat after the close of Liverpool, but offer ings were absorbed on moderate set backs, and the market held steady late in the morning. At midday December was holding around 12.30 and March 12 43, with active months ruling about 3 to 4 points net higher. Chicago Grain By the Associated Près». CHICAGO, November 16. — New peaks for corn prices distinguished grain trading today. Reports said one reason for corn market strength was removal of hedges here against liberal purchases of oosh corn which is now in the East. There was also constant reiteration of ad vices from Illinois and Iowa points in dicating truckers were paying farmers above the prices current in Chicago, and in some cases equal to more than $1 a bushel on track here. Corn closed irregular, at % cent decline to 1% advance compared with yesterday's finish: May, 84a<94>/8; wheat easy, % to IK off; May. 99'/2a 99%: oats varying from \\ decline to gain, and provisions at 5 cents de cline to a rise of 2 cents. November 18 (/P>.—Bar silver barely steady. V» lower at 54H. REVENUE FREIGHT SHOWSDECREASE Association of American Railroads Makes Report for Week. By the Associated Press. The Association of American Rail-· roads announced today that loadings of revenue ireight for the week ended November 10 were 594,932 cars, a ce crease of 17,525 from the preceding week, but an increase of 11,859 above 1933 and 58,245 above 1932. The association said the decrease last week was caused primarily by a holiday in many places on election day. Miscellaneous freight loaded to taled 224,201 cars, a decrease of 10, 817 below the preceding week, but 18,120 above 1933 and 36,964 above 1932. Merchandise Lots. Less than carlot merchandise was 160,588 cars, a decrease of 1,949 be low the preceding week, 5,515 below 1933 and 8,991 below 1932. Coal loaded amounted to 125,403 cars, an increase of 1,115 above the preceding week, 2,867 above 1933 and 11,795 above 1932. Grain and grain products totaled 27,251 cars, a decrease of 619 below the preceding week and 670 below last year, but 2,147 above 1932. In the Western districts loadings totaled 16, 786 cars, a decrease of 1,353 below 1933. Live stock amounted to 23,055 cars, a decrease of 1,502 below the preced ing week, but an increase of 1,140 above 1933 and 4,752 above 1932. Live Stock Loadings. In the Western districts live stock loadings totaled 17,369 cars, an in crease of 281 over 1933. Forest products totaled 21,380 cars, a decrease of 260 below the preceding week and 2,610 below 1933, but an in crease of 5,412 over 1932. Ore loaded amounted to 7,488 cars, a decrease of 3.221 below the preced ing week and 1.243 below 1933, but an increase of 4,691 over 1932. Coke totaled 5,568 cars, a decrease of 272 below the preceding week and 230 below 1933, but an increase of 1, 475 over 1932. NEW YORK PRODUCE. NEW YORK.
